Shrove Tuesday Mardi Gras 
On Tuesday, March 5th, we will be holding our annual youth-sponsored Shrove Tuesday Mardi Gras event.   
 
Starting at 6pm in Board Hall, we'll honor the traditional eating of breakfast for dinner.  There'll be plenty of live music on the stage, and a King & Queen cake, complete with a hidden baby Jesus, so that we can crown our new Shrove Tuesday royalty.   
Contributions will be taken at the door, and all profits will be used for youth outreach efforts.  The youth of Anchorage Presbyterian will be working with ours for this event.  We know that will make it even more crowded than usual, but don't let that dampen your enthusiasm.   
 
Let's make a good showing to welcome our guests and support the youth of both congregations.
 
Ash Wednesday Services 
On Wednesday, March 6th, we will begin a holy observance of Lent with Ash Wednesday.  Imposition of Ashes and Holy Communion will be offered at 7am, 12noon, and 7pm.   
 
We encourage everyone to participate in this act of penitence and perspective-building, as we are all reminded that each of us "is dust, and to dust shall return."

St. Luke's Annual Silver Tea Event 
St. Luke's Annual Silver Tea will be Sunday, February 17, in Board Hall following the 10:00am service.   St. Luke's has hosted the Silver Tea for over 45 years. Donations support Home of the Innocents which provides shelter and care for children who are without support when their families are in trouble. A representative for the Home will speak at the Tea.
 
This year's Tea reception will feature tea, coffee, wine, etc. and finger foods. Anyone who can donate, please bring finger foods to Board Hall. If you need child care, please contact the church office in advance and we will gladly provide it. Come enjoy the fellowship and participate in outreach.
 
In 2011, St. Luke's received the Childfriend of the Year award from Home of the Innocents for all the support we have given them over these many years. Let's generously support the Home again this year!

St. Luke's Book Club 
YOU ARE INVITED to St Luke's Book Club on February 19 at 6:00.  
 
Our book selection for February is The Story of Edgar Sawtelle written by David Wroblewski.
This book is, all at once, a mystery, a thriller, a ghost story, and a literary tour de force.  It is an authentic epic, long and lush, full of backstory and observed detail which mimics life.  Edgar was born mute, led an angelic life on a remote Wisconsin farm with some wonderful, unique Sawtelle dogs until his Father mysteriously died.  He and his mother attempted to continue the kennel operations and administration.  His Uncle started to help them and then...!   
 
MEETING INFO : Lyman House, February 19, THIRD (3rd) Tuesday monthly at 6:00 PM for 2+- hours of rousing conversations and introductions to books of almost every genre. At the end of each meeting, we discuss books for the next month's selection, so bring your suggestions with you. We invite you to join us!

Lay Pastoral Care Ministry 
Pastoral care is a ministry provided by volunteer parishioners to individuals needing home, hospital, nursing home or rehabilitation facility visitations. Arrangements can be made for communion and meals as requested. All information is confidential unless you give permission to share with others.

CALL THE CHURCH OFFICE TO LET US KNOW YOUR NEEDS.

Reminder, if you do go to the hospital, let the hospital know your church affiliation or try to have your caregiver do so.

March 2 & 3 / Guest Minister 
On the weekend of March 2 and 3, we will welcome the Reverend Holly Ostlund as our preacher at all 3 of our Eucharist.   
 
She will also offer a presentation at 9:00 on Sunday in Board Hall and give us an opportunity to ask questions.  An Episcopal priest, she speaks for the Third World destitute served by Food For The Poor, an interdenominational ministry providing food, clothing, medical care, housing, school supplies and economic development programs in the Caribbean and Latin America.   
 
Rev. Holly travels most weekends for Food For The Poor introducing people of The First World to the people of The Third World.  Holly lives in Palm Beach Gardens, FL with her adult son, Grant and canine 'rescue,' Sahara.  Weekdays Holly is a Palm Beach County hospice chaplain
